Resilience and Determination
Overcoming Setbacks
Every entrepreneur faces setbacks, but Musk's resilience in the face of adversity is particularly noteworthy. From near bankruptcy at Tesla to failed rocket launches at SpaceX, he has encountered numerous obstacles. However, his determination to persevere has been crucial in overcoming these challenges.

To build resilience, view setbacks as opportunities for growth rather than insurmountable barriers. Develop a mindset that embraces challenges and leverages them to build a stronger foundation for future success.
